Output faad05c439f602cd8ed5ba17fe82f37dedded21c138c97c755de83ccd7ec4f78:1

value
585649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3c3e1244419b9f5e4fa29e5db025e7d272b1377 OP_EQUAL
address
3Puvn6sNsDG8bsSggfZ1QrsichJkmZ6V9i
transaction
faad05c439f602cd8ed5ba17fe82f37dedded21c138c97c755de83ccd7ec4f78
confirmations
164878
spent
true